Our client, a growing innovator in food additive manufacturing and process technology, is seeking a Process Development Engineer to lead new product and equipment development using computational fluid modeling and experimental design. This role offers a unique opportunity to work across R&D, pilot plant design, and hands-on implementation, supporting both food and emerging chemical industry clients. Approximately 60% of the role focuses on in-house innovation and process design, 20% involves working directly with technicians on the floor, and 20% is dedicated to setting up and analyzing experiments.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Develop new processes and equipment using CFD tools (FLUENT or COMSOL) and apply modeling to support design decisions.
  • Create detailed CAD diagrams and technical documentation for internal teams and outside fabricators.
  • Collaborate with chemists, engineers, and technicians on design execution and implementation.
  • Translate in-house ideas and client requests into technical solutions and pilot plant recommendations.
  • Support lab and pilot-scale testing, including experimental design and troubleshooting.
  • Spend time on the production floor supporting installation, scale-up, and validation of new systems.
  • Contribute to production support activities and technology transfer from R&D to full-scale operations.
